Sleep files for Node.js
npm install sleepfile
const Sleepfile = require('sleepfile')
const ram = require('random-access-memory')
const file = new Sleepfile(ram())
file.put(42, Buffer.alloc(42), function (err) {
console.log('Inserted an entry at index 42')
file.get(42, function (err, buf) {
console.log('Read it out again')
})
})
Create a new sleep file. Storage should be a random-access-storage instance.
Options include
{
magicBytes: 0x00000000, // set a magic bytes header of the file
valueSize: 42, // explicitly set the valueSize (infered on first put otherwise)
valueEncoding: encoding, // optionally set an abstract-encoding for the values
name: 'algo', // optionally set the algorithm name in the header
overwrite: false // reset the file content
}
Insert a value at an index.
Insert an array of values starting at offset.
Get the value at index.
Get an array of values starting at offset.
Get metadata about the sleepfile itself. Returned object looks like this:
{
magicBytes: 0x00000000, // the magic bytes stored
version: 0, // sleep version
valueSize: 42,
name: 'algo name',
length: 42, // how many values are there maximum
density: 0.60 // how much of the underlying storage are actually in use
}
Get the value out with the highest index, i.e. stat.length - 1
.
If the file is empty null
is returned.
